Cummings et al., J Biol Chem 2004
(Inflammation) :
Here, we report that protein kinase Cdelta (PKCdelta) mediates
LPA induced
NF-kappaB transcription and interleukin-8 (IL-8) secretion in HBEpCs ...
LPA caused a marked activation of NF-kappaB in HBEpCs as determined by IkappaB phosphorylation and of NF-kappaB nuclear translocation and a strong induction of
NF-kappaB promoter
mediated luciferase activity ... Furthermore, LPA activated PKCdelta and the
LPA mediated activation of
NF-kappaB and IL-8 production were attenuated by overexpression of dominant negative PKCdelta and rottlerin

Klemm et al., Proc Natl Acad Sci U S A 2007
:
Here, we identify the adapter proteins Bcl10 and Malt1 as essential mediators of
LPA induced
NF-kappaB activation ... By using murine embryonic fibroblasts from Bcl10- or Malt1-deficient mice as a genetic model, we report that Bcl10 and Malt1 are critically required for the degradation of IkappaB-alpha and the subsequent
NF-kappaB induction in
response to
LPA stimulation ... Bcl10 and Malt1 cooperate with PKCs selectively for
LPA induced
NF-kappaB activation but are dispensable for the activation of the Jnk, p38, Erk MAP kinase, and Akt signaling pathways

Sun et al., J Biol Chem 2010
:
MEKK3 is a central intermediate signaling component in
lysophosphatidic acid (LPA) induced activation of the
nuclear factor-kappaB (NF-kappaB) ... Furthermore, knockdown of PP2Ac expression enhances
LPA induced MEKK3 mediated IkappaB kinase beta (IKKbeta) phosphorylation and
NF-kappaB activation ... These data suggest that PP2A plays an important role in the termination of
LPA mediated
NF-kappaB activation through dephosphorylating and inactivating MEKK3
